Beta implementation of Windows Live Messenger IM Control. Language changes accordingly for Japanese and Traditional and Simplified Chinese. Default language for the messenger would be US English.

Individual users may customise the theme for their own embedded messenger and have the option of selecting the messenger or button presence format. After enabling the module you would not see any administration page. Only a tab would be added to each user's account page for individual setup.

Edit the included css file to set the messenger size and other styling options. Privacy policy must be created at http://www.example.com/privacy

User's online status in Drupal is now shown on the profile page beside the "Member for" value. (You may edit the time a user is considered online within the code; by default the time is 5 minutes)

***NEW*** Includes support for Yahoo, QQ and Skype online status
(may have problems as these do not have an official API for implementation)

PHP low memory usage: ~26,000 bytes
